[13.0] hr_timesheet_time_sheet: Field res.company.sheet_range with non-str value in selection #402

During install of the hr_timesheet_time_sheet module in Odoo 13 community edition, the stacktrace below is produced. This is related to recent changes in Odoo 13 handling of the Selection field # and #.

AssertionError: Field res.company.sheet_range with non-str value in selection

@gjhagens-shrd I guess you upgraded the database from an old version to 13.0. In this case, the conversion of the values of sheet_range field is automatically executed by this OpenUpgrade script within module hr_timesheet_sheet. If you upgraded the database to V13 with a different method, other than OpenUpgrade, you should manually convert the values or create your own script.

You could check the database directly.
The field sheet_range of table res_company shall contain only the following strings:
MONTHLY
WEEKLY
DAILY
You can fix the values manually in case they are wrong.

An alternative quick-and-dirty way to fix it could be by deleting field sheet_range from table res_company and update the module again.
